The Peugeot 208 Facelift 2015 (2015-2018) was offered with 5 distinct engine configurations across its trim range.
| Engine | Power | Torque | Transmission | Drive | Top speed | 0-100 km/h | Consumption | Available on |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1.6L Petrol | 208 hp | 300 Nm | Manual | Front Wheel Drive | 230 km/h | 6.8 s | 5.9 l/100km | 2 trims |
| 1.2L Petrol | 110 hp | 205 Nm | Manual | Front Wheel Drive | 190 km/h | 9.6 s | 4.5 l/100km | 1 trim |
| 1.6L Diesel | 102 hp | 254 Nm | Manual | Front Wheel Drive | 187 km/h | 10.7 s | 3.4 l/100km | 2 trims |
| 1.2L Petrol | 82 hp | 118 Nm | Manual | Front Wheel Drive | 178 km/h | 12.2 s | 4.3 l/100km | 2 trims |
| 1.0L Petrol | 68 hp | 95 Nm | Manual | Front Wheel Drive | 163 km/h | 14.0 s | 4.4 l/100km | 1 trim |
Each row is a distinct mechanical configuration — engine size, power output, transmission, drivetrain and fuel type — deduplicated across equipment trims that share the same engine. Trim-only differences (interior, wheels, options) do not create a separate row.
